## Hunting leaked file descriptors in Fennelbox plugins

If your plugin keeps sockets open after teardown, the Fennelbox host will eventually hit the descriptor ceiling and refuse new connections. Run the fd-census probe against your sandbox instance, then diff the output before and after a plugin reload. Anything that survives three reload cycles is leaked. To query the fd-census aggregator directly, authenticate with the key below.

API key for tagug-tajef: vxb4-R1fo

# Artifact Signing — GiftNote Mailer

The GiftNote donation-receipt mailer ships as a single container image. Build from the release branch only. Verify the template bundle hash matches the manifest before signing — mismatches mean a stale receipt layout went out last quarter and Finance noticed. Signing happens in the sealed runner; never sign locally. Rotate quarterly per the Opaline security calendar. The registry refuses unsigned pushes, full stop. The current signing key for release artifacts is shown below.

deploy key for yadup-yagep: bky3_u5w

**Onboarding: Crashwell Pipeline Access**

The Pinefold mobile app ships crash reports to the Crashwell pipeline, which deduplicates stack traces and files triage tickets automatically. As release manager, you gate symbol uploads: every build must push its dSYM bundle before promotion, or reports arrive unsymbolicated. Verify ingestion health on the Crashwell dashboard after each release candidate. To authorize symbol uploads, use the internal key below.

gateway credential: kto3_qfe

[ ] Weekly cash-box run — Thornley branch. The sealed cash box departs the Mabsen counting room every Friday at 09:30 and arrives at the receiving site before 11:00. Receiving staff verify the tamper seal number against the transit slip and sign both copies before the driver leaves. The confidential courier hand-over instruction for this run is stated below.

handover note for kajop-yawep: the ulair jorox courier leaves the belax ledger at gate 9133 under passcode 401596